I called weathertech and on the Navi you gotta trim out the area around the front console. According to the customer service rep this wasn’t on the website nor is the dotted line you are supposed to cut on integrated on the first run production mats. So I measured and cut and it fits like a glove. I’ll keep the 2nd, 3rd and bsr cargo in and swap out the fronts as needed. Totally happy with the kid proofing.

Does anyone have experience with the Canvasback liners?

https://www.canvasback.com/index.php/ford-expedition-cargo-liners-2018.html

I've got the short Expy and am looking for something that will cover the back of the third row seats when folded down but that I don't have to remove every time I use those seats. This seems to fit pretty well and also allows access to the storage tray behind the third row. I believe it sticks to the carpet using velcro; I just wonder how well it stays in place.

With weathertech, I'd need to get the bigger version that goes behind the 2nd row, and then remove it when I have the third row folded up, which doesn't sound appealing to me.
